Today I am reviewing the Princess Pinky Foxy Brown lenses. These have a 8.6mm base curve and are 14.5mm in diameter. These lenses are also annually disposables so please discard them after this time to prevent discomfort and/or damage to your eyes. I personally don't keep annual disposables for the entire period of use and usually discard them after 3-6 months of use to ensure optimal eye health.

Color: ♥♥♥♡♡
These are similar to the grey variant in that it doesn't really look brown on my eyes. I'd say it's more of an olive or hazel which is pretty but not what I was expecting. That being said it shows up very vividly on my eyes and you can barely see my natural eye color so this is great for those who have trouble finding natural looking opaque lenses!

Design: ♥♥♥
This lens design is just as beautiful as the grey variant. The jagged limbal ring makes it less harsh but still gives a nice and subtle enlargement effect without making you look bug-eyed.
Enlargement: ♥♥♡♡
The enlargement on these is present but subtle for a lens with a limbal ring in the design. I think it's slightly more enlarging than the grey variant just because of the way it contrasts with the lens color but it's still very much on the natural side.

Comfort: ♥♥♥♥
I wore these for about 6-7 hours and didn't experience any discomfort, irritation, or dryness.

Overall: ♥♥♥
I think these are a beautiful way to play up brown eyes. They are great for people who love to wear darker or more contrasting makeup looks as it will give your eyes a bit of pop. I can wear these for simple or natural looks without feeling like they are too extreme as well so overall this is a really solid brown lens. I think these would be great for anyone who has trouble finding brown lenses that show up on their eyes!
